Door Frames

A sturdy frame and a decorative board will surround your patio door, no matter if it's hinged or sliding. This creates a stunning architectural aspect to your home. In the past wood was the material of choice since it is elegant and traditional however the drawbacks are that it is more expensive than other materials and susceptible to weather-based damage. However, advancements in technology and materials allow homeowners to select from a range of frames that are sturdy, cost-efficient and low maintenance.

Sliding patio doors are very popular because they're space efficient and are easy to open or closed. This type of door is supported by steel rollers and slides back and forth on a track that is built into the frame. If the tracks wear out or damaged, or if the rollers cease to glide on the track and stop moving, it's time to replace them. Before replacing the sliding patio door ensure that you have access to the glass pane by taking it off of the glazing. This can be done by gently lifting the glass up while holding both sides. If you have an opening with a track made of metal and is older, remove any rivets or screws prior to taking off the entire frame.

It's easy to find replacement rollers in a local hardware store. They can be screwed into the track. You should first clean the track, and then lubricate it using silicone lubricant. This will ensure that your new rollers run effortlessly and won't get stuck or break after repeated use.

It is crucial to verify the frame's level and squareness before putting it in. Tap the frame with a hammer and a level until you have an even line on the top and sides of the opening. If your frame isn't level, you will notice a gap at the bottom of your doorway. This could be a trip hazard.

If you do not want to replace the door, you could use a piece aluminum flashing tape over the floor sill. This will create a ramp that keeps the door's bottom level with your flooring. This is a simple fix that will stop tripping and improve the durability of your patio doors. You can also buy a sheet of aluminum plate from an hardware store to cover the entire floor sill and provide stability to the frame.

Sliding Tracks

Sliding glass doors are a popular design feature in rooms which connect to the outside. They can be used in kitchens, closets, and to conceal appliances like furnaces and water heaters. If they're not opening properly, it could be due to a damaged track or dirty wheels. Follow these simple repair and maintenance procedures to keep your sliding-door tracks and rollers in good shape and your door operating smoothly.

First, vacuum to remove any loose dirt or dust. Then, use a small brush (such as an old toothbrush) to scrub the entire surface of the track, including the area that isn't moving when the door is shut. After cleaning the track, vacuum it to get rid of any dirt that was loosen.

Next, spray the track with a lubricant compatible with your track material. Vinyl tracks require a special fluid to prevent them from becoming sticky. Wood tracks need a lubricant which won't attract dirt or cause rust. Contact a lumberyard, or a home center to locate the correct product for your track.

Once the track is clean, rehang the door and then reattach it to the top rollers. Find the adjusting screws for the bottom track (if your system has one) and tighten them when necessary. Then, adjust the rollers so that the gap between the door and the jamb is equal.

If your doors still don't slide smoothly, it's likely the casters (wheels) are damaged or have become disintegrated. You can buy replacements at home improvement stores or online. They're simple to install and can help your doors roll more smoothly than they did before.

You can replace your rollers if still in good condition, but not functioning properly. Take the track off and then take off the old wheels. Then, insert the new ones onto the track and then reattach them to the door. You can purchase new tracks from most hardware and home improvement stores if they are bent or damaged. Hinges

French patio doors are also referred to as hinged patio doors. They are very popular with homeowners who desire a an architectural style that is traditional for their home and also to take in the views. The doors are mounted on hinges and can either open outward or inward to allow more light and space for moving about the home. But, hinges can sometimes become stuck or create an eerie sound that is a sign of damage or poor maintenance. To keep your hinges working well, make sure you lubricate them regularly with a silicone spray designed specifically for hinges for doors.

The hinges of your patio doors are stuck. This is a common issue that can be a source of frustration for homeowners, but it is typically an easy fix. To resolve the issue, start by removing the plastic covers from the screws for adjustment on the hinges. Then with a screwdriver adjust the hinges by turning them clockwise or counterclockwise to fine-tune the positioning. After the screws have been tightened, dnpaint.co.kr remove the plastic covers to test the hinges.

Depending on your patio door type, you may need to replace the hinge pins if the hinge is loose or damaged. This is an easy DIY project you can tackle with the use of common tools, or you can hire a professional to fix the part for you.

The tracks and hinges on sliding patio doors are prone to rust and other damages particularly in humid climates. In addition, frequent use can cause them to become out of alignment and affect their movement and cause issues opening and closing the doors. A skilled repair technician can restore proper alignment and replace worn track and hinges in order to improve the efficiency of your energy use.

The handles and locks on sliding patio doors are a different area to be concerned about. For safety and security, it is important to fix handles that are shaky or difficult to use. Locksmiths can fix damaged locks or rusted locks to ensure they function correctly. Also, damaged or cracked glass can compromise the integrity of patio doors. It is recommended to repair the damage as soon as possible. A window specialist or door repair company can fix your glass. This is an inexpensive and quick fix.
